Cursor是一款基于VS Code构建的AI原生代码编辑器,专为开发者设计,深度集成了Claude、GPT等先进大语言模型,提供智能代码补全、实时调试、自然语言编程等强大功能。对于Java开发、系统构建、学术论文代码实现等场景,Cursor能显著提升开发效率,降低技术门槛。本教程将从系统准备、安装配置、模型选择到功能实操,全面讲解Windows平台的使用方法,帮助你快速掌握这款高效工具。
1.1 硬件与系统要求
配置项
最低要求
推荐配置
操作系统
Windows 10 64位
Windows 11 64位
内存
4GB RAM
8GB+ RAM
硬盘空间
500MB 可用
1GB+ 可用
网络
稳定互联网连接
高速网络(模型下载/更新)
处理器
x64 架构
多核处理器
1.2 准备工作
- 确认系统为64位Windows(Cursor仅支持64位系统)
- 关闭防火墙/杀毒软件的拦截提示(安装时可能需要)
- 准备好网络连接(AI功能依赖云端服务)
- 可选:注册Cursor账号(官网:https://www.cursor.com);
2.1 方法一:官方安装包安装(推荐)
步骤1:下载安装包
- 打开浏览器访问Cursor官网:https://www.cursor.com/
- 点击页面中央Download for free按钮,自动识别Windows系统
- 下载约350MB的.exe安装包,等待完成
步骤2:执行安装程序
- 找到下载的
cursor-setup.exe文件,右键选择以管理员身份运行(关键!避免权限问题) - 用户账户控制(UAC)提示时点击是
- 进入安装向导,按以下步骤配置:
- 选择安装路径:默认
C:Users用户名AppDataLocalProgramsCursor,可自定义 - 勾选Create a desktop shortcut(创建桌面快捷方式)
- 勾选Add to PATH (requires shell restart)(添加到系统环境变量,方便终端调用)
- 点击Install开始安装,等待1-2分钟
- 选择安装路径:默认
步骤3:完成安装
- 安装完成后,点击Finish启动Cursor
- 首次启动会自动加载必要组件,稍等片刻进入主界面
2.2 方法二:PowerShell安装(Windows 11推荐)
步骤1:打开PowerShell
- 按下
Win+X组合键,选择Windows PowerShell (管理员) 或 终端(管理员)
步骤2:执行安装命令
# 使用winget工具安装(Windows 11内置) winget install Cursor.Cursor
步骤3:确认安装
- 按提示输入
Y确认安装 - 等待安装完成后,在开始菜单找到Cursor启动
3.1 启动与初始化
- 桌面双击Cursor图标,或从开始菜单启动
- 首次启动会显示欢迎界面,点击Next逐步引导
- 同意用户协议,选择界面语言(默认中文)
3.2 账号登录(关键)
Cursor提供两种使用模式:
- 免费模式:无需登录,可作为VS Code使用,但AI功能有限额
- 会员模式:登录后解锁全部AI功能,支持自定义模型配置
登录方式
- 点击右上角登录按钮
- 支持Google/GitHub账号快速登录,或邮箱注册登录
- 登录成功后,可在设置中查看会员权益与配额
Cursor支持多种AI模型,包括OpenAI系列、Anthropic Claude系列及本地模型,不同模型适用于不同开发场景。以下是详细的模型选择与配置指南。
4.1 模型分类与适用场景
模型类型
具体模型
特点
适用场景
Claude系列(推荐)
Claude 3.5 Sonnet
编程能力最强,逻辑推理、代码生成、重构表现卓越
复杂项目开发、代码重构、学术论文代码实现
Claude 3 Opus
性能更强,适合超大规模项目
企业级系统开发、多文件协同开发
OpenAI系列
GPT-4o
综合能力强,多模态支持好
通用开发、简单代码生成、文档生成
GPT-3.5 Turbo
速度快,成本低
简单任务、快速迭代、代码检查
本地模型
CodeLlama、DeepSeek-Coder
离线可用,隐私性好
敏感数据项目、无网络环境开发
4.2 模型配置步骤
步骤1:打开设置界面
有三种方式打开设置:
- 快捷键:
Ctrl+,(Windows系统) - 点击左下角设置图标(齿轮形状)
- 命令面板:
Ctrl+Shift+P,输入Preferences: Open Settings (JSON)
步骤2:配置AI模型(三种方式)
方式一:图形界面配置(新手推荐)
- 打开设置后,在搜索框输入AI或Models
- 找到AI Model下拉菜单,选择默认模型
- 可分别配置:
- Chat模型:用于对话交流、代码解释
- Composer模型:用于代码生成、重构
- Autocomplete模型:用于实时代码补全
方式二:JSON配置文件(高级用户)
打开settings.json文件,添加以下配置:
{ // 聊天模型配置 “cursor.chat.model”: “claude-3.5-sonnet”, // 代码生成模型配置 “cursor.composer.model”: “claude-3.5-sonnet”, // 自动补全模型配置 “cursor.autocomplete.model”: “cursor-small”, // 上下文窗口大小(16k/32k/128k) “cursor.ai.contextSize”: “16k”, // 温度参数(0-1,越高越随机) “cursor.ai.temperature”: 0.7, // 最大生成长度 “cursor.ai.maxTokens”: 2048 }
方式三:临时切换模型
在Chat面板或Composer界面,点击模型名称下拉菜单,临时切换模型,不影响全局设置。
4.3 模型配置推荐方案
方案1:高效开发组合(推荐)
{ “cursor.chat.model”: “claude-3.5-sonnet”, “cursor.composer.model”: “claude-3.5-sonnet”, “cursor.autocomplete.model”: “cursor-small”, “cursor.ai.contextSize”: “32k”, “cursor.ai.temperature”: 0.6 }
方案2:成本优化组合
{ “cursor.chat.model”: “gpt-4o”, “cursor.composer.model”: “gpt-3.5-turbo”, “cursor.autocomplete.model”: “cursor-small”, “cursor.ai.contextSize”: “16k” }
方案3:离线开发组合(需本地部署Ollama)
{ “cursor.chat.model”: “ollama://codellama:7b”, “cursor.composer.model”: “ollama://deepseek-coder:13b”, “cursor.autocomplete.model”: “cursor-small” }
4.4 模型API配置(会员专属)
Pro+会员可配置自定义API,支持第三方兼容模型:
- 打开设置,找到AI API Configuration
- 输入API地址、API密钥、模型名称
- 保存后即可使用自定义模型
5.1 智能代码补全
Cursor的核心功能,基于上下文智能生成代码:
- 编写代码时,AI会自动给出补全建议
- 按下Tab键接受建议,Esc键拒绝
- 支持复杂逻辑补全,如Java类、函数、循环结构等
5.2 内联代码编辑(Ctrl+K)
选中代码后按下Ctrl+K,打开编辑框,可实现:
- 代码重构:优化代码结构、提高可读性
- 代码解释:生成详细注释、解释代码逻辑
- 错误修复:自动检测并修复代码错误
- 语言转换:将Java代码转为Python/C++等
5.3 AI对话功能(Ctrl+I/Ctrl+L)
按下Ctrl+I打开Chat面板,支持:
- 代码问答:针对选中代码提问,如“优化这段Java代码性能”
- 项目分析:分析整个项目结构,给出改进建议
- 文档生成:根据代码生成API文档、使用说明
- 学习指导:解释技术概念、提供学习资源
5.4 代码生成(Composer)
- 按下
Ctrl+Shift+I打开Composer - 输入自然语言需求,如“使用Java SpringBoot框架实现一个用户管理系统,包含增删改查功能”
- 选择模型,点击生成,AI会自动生成完整代码
- 支持分步生成、代码片段插入等功能
5.5 项目管理与集成
- 支持打开本地文件夹、Git仓库
- 集成VS Code插件生态,可安装Java、Maven、MySQL等插件
- 支持断点调试、代码格式化、语法检查等基础功能
6.1 AI核心快捷键
快捷键
功能
Tab
接受代码补全建议
Ctrl+K
内联代码编辑
Ctrl+I / Ctrl+L
打开Chat面板
Ctrl+Shift+I
打开Composer
Ctrl+Shift+P
打开命令面板
6.2 编辑类快捷键
快捷键
功能
Ctrl+C/Ctrl+V
复制/粘贴
Ctrl+Z/Ctrl+Y
撤销/重做
Ctrl+F
查找
Ctrl+H
替换
Ctrl+A
全选
Ctrl+S
保存
6.3 导航类快捷键
快捷键
功能
Ctrl+P
快速跳转文件
Ctrl+Shift+O
跳转至符号
Ctrl+G
跳转至指定行
Alt+←/Alt+→
后退/前进
Ctrl+PageUp/PageDown
切换标签页
6.4 窗口管理快捷键
快捷键
功能
Ctrl+W
关闭当前标签页
Ctrl+Shift+W
关闭所有标签页
Ctrl+Shift+N
新建窗口
Ctrl+Shift+T
恢复关闭的标签页
7.1 安装问题
- 安装包无法运行
- 原因:系统缺少运行库、权限不足
- 解决:以管理员身份运行,安装.NET Framework 4.8+
- 安装过程中被防火墙拦截
- 解决:临时关闭防火墙,安装完成后恢复
- 安装失败,提示权限不足
- 解决:检查安装路径权限,或更换安装路径至非系统盘
7.2 启动问题
- 启动后闪退
- 原因:内存不足、缓存损坏
- 解决:关闭其他程序,删除缓存目录
C:Users用户名.cursor,重新启动
- 界面显示异常
- 原因:显卡驱动问题、主题冲突
- 解决:更新显卡驱动,切换至默认主题
7.3 AI功能问题
- 模型加载失败
- 原因:网络问题、API密钥错误
- 解决:检查网络连接,确认API密钥正确,切换至免费模型测试
- 代码生成错误
- 原因:需求描述不清晰、模型选择不当
- 解决:优化需求描述,使用更精确的自然语言,选择合适模型
- 本地模型无法使用
- 原因:未安装Ollama、模型未下载
- 解决:安装Ollama,下载对应模型(如
ollama pull codellama)
8.1 性能优化
- 降低上下文窗口大小,提升响应速度
- 关闭不必要的插件,减少资源占用
- 定期清理缓存,保持编辑器流畅
8.2 个性化配置
- 安装主题插件(如Monokai、GitHub Dark)
- 配置字体(推荐Consolas、JetBrains Mono)
- 导入VS Code快捷键配置,降低学习成本
8.3 高效开发流程
- 先使用Composer生成项目骨架,再逐步细化功能
- 利用Chat面板进行代码审查,提高代码质量
- 结合版本管理,定期提交代码,保留历史版本
8.4 学术论文开发场景应用
- 代码生成:根据论文需求生成Java/SpringBoot项目代码
- 模型选择:使用Claude 3.5 Sonnet生成复杂算法代码
- 文档生成:自动生成论文相关的技术文档、注释说明
- 代码优化:对生成的代码进行性能优化、bug修复
本教程详细介绍了Windows系统安装与使用Cursor AI编辑器的完整流程,从系统准备、安装配置到模型选择、功能实操,覆盖了从新手入门到进阶应用的全场景。Cursor作为一款强大的AI原生编辑器,能显著提升开发效率,尤其适合Java开发、系统构建、学术论文代码实现等场景。
通过合理配置模型、熟练掌握快捷键、灵活运用核心功能,你可以充分发挥Cursor的潜力,大幅降低开发难度,提升工作效率。建议根据自身需求选择合适的模型配置,不断实践探索,打造个性化的开发环境。
需要我把教程里的快捷键整理成可直接复制的速查表,并补充Java/SpringBoot项目的3个实战示例(含完整代码与模型配置)吗?
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容,请联系我们,一经查实,本站将立刻删除。
如需转载请保留出处:https://51itzy.com/kjqy/252562.html